Lesson 4: Navigating the Dynamics – Supply Chain Drivers and Obstacles
The Levers and the Landmines: What Makes a Supply Chain Tick (or Trip)
Part 1: Supply Chain Drivers – The Levers of Performance
Think of these drivers as fundamental decision areas within any supply chain. By making strategic choices in each of these areas, companies can enhance their supply chain's efficiency (cost) and responsiveness (speed, flexibility, quality).
There are typically six key drivers, categorized by how they primarily impact the supply chain:
1. Facilities:
Definition: The physical locations in the supply chain network where products are manufactured, stored, or shipped.
Strategic Decisions:
Location: Where to place factories, warehouses, distribution centers? (Proximity to customers, suppliers, labor, infrastructure).
Capacity: How large should facilities be? (Impacts ability to meet demand, economies of scale).
Flexibility: How easily can the facility adapt to changing product mix or demand?
Type: Manufacturing plants, warehouses, cross-dock facilities, retail stores.
Impact:
Efficiency: Consolidating facilities, optimizing layouts, utilizing automation.
Responsiveness: Locating facilities closer to customers for faster delivery, having redundant facilities for risk mitigation.
2. Inventory:
Definition: The raw materials, work-in-process goods, and finished goods that are held within the supply chain.
Strategic Decisions:
Cycle Inventory: How much to order/produce at a time? (Impacts ordering/setup costs vs. holding costs).
Safety Inventory: How much extra inventory to hold to buffer against demand/supply uncertainty? (Impacts responsiveness vs. holding costs).
Seasonal Inventory: How much to build up in anticipation of predictable demand spikes?
Sourcing: Where to hold inventory (centralized vs. decentralized).
Impact:
Efficiency: Minimizing inventory holding costs, reducing obsolescence.
Responsiveness: Having sufficient inventory to meet immediate customer demand, mitigating stockouts.
3. Transportation:
Definition: The movement of inventory from one point to another in the supply chain.
Strategic Decisions:
Mode: Which mode to use? (Air, rail, road, sea, pipeline, multimodal – considering cost, speed, capacity, reliability).
Route & Network: Optimal paths for goods movement.
In-house vs. Outsourced: Manage own fleet or use 3PLs?
Consolidation: Grouping shipments to achieve economies of scale.
Impact:
Efficiency: Choosing the lowest-cost mode, optimizing routes, maximizing vehicle utilization.
Responsiveness: Using faster modes (air freight), direct shipping, frequent small shipments.
4. Information:
Definition: Data and analysis concerning facilities, inventory, transportation, costs, prices, customers, and suppliers. The most crucial driver as it impacts all others.
Strategic Decisions:
Accuracy & Timeliness: Ensuring data is correct and available when needed.
Sharing: What information to share with partners and how?
Technology: ERP systems, SCM software, data analytics, predictive modeling.
Decision Support: Using information to forecast demand, plan production, optimize routes.
Impact:
Efficiency: Better forecasting reduces excess inventory and rush orders, optimizing resource allocation.
Responsiveness: Real-time visibility enables quicker reactions to disruptions, improved customer service.
5. Sourcing:
Definition: The selection of suppliers and the procurement of goods and services.
Strategic Decisions:
Supplier Selection: How to evaluate and choose suppliers? (Cost, quality, reliability, sustainability).
Contracting: Types of agreements with suppliers.
Relationship Management: Building partnerships vs. transactional relationships.
Global Sourcing: Sourcing from international markets.
Impact:
Efficiency: Negotiating favorable prices, consolidating suppliers, reducing purchasing costs.
Responsiveness: Having multiple reliable suppliers, suppliers located closer to manufacturing, flexible contract terms.
6. Pricing:
Definition: The prices at which products and services are sold to customers. This driver directly influences demand and profitability.
Strategic Decisions:
Pricing Strategy: Cost-plus, value-based, dynamic pricing, promotional pricing.
Quantity Discounts: Offering lower prices for larger orders.
Seasonal Pricing: Adjusting prices based on demand patterns.
Revenue Management: Optimizing pricing to maximize revenue and capacity utilization (e.g., airline tickets).
Impact:
Efficiency: Influences demand variability, which impacts production and inventory levels, leading to cost optimization.
Responsiveness: Dynamic pricing can help manage demand peaks and troughs, improving utilization and fulfillment.
Part 2: Supply Chain Obstacles – The Landmines of Complexity
While drivers offer opportunities for optimization, supply chains are inherently complex and face numerous challenges that can lead to inefficiencies, delays, and dissatisfied customers.
1. Uncertainty:
Description: The unpredictable nature of demand, supply, and external factors.
Sources:
Demand Uncertainty: Fluctuations in customer orders, changing preferences.
Supply Uncertainty: Supplier reliability issues, quality problems, raw material availability.
Economic Uncertainty: Recessions, currency fluctuations, inflation.
Impact: Leads to excess inventory (cost) or stockouts (lost sales, unhappy customers).
2. Complexity:
Description: The sheer number of entities, relationships, processes, and products within a supply chain.
Sources:
Global Sourcing: Managing suppliers across different countries, cultures, regulations.
Product Variety: More product SKUs mean more inventory, more complex forecasting.
Multiple Channels: Selling online, in stores, through distributors adds complexity.
Integration Challenges: Connecting disparate IT systems of different partners.
Impact: Difficult to coordinate, higher administrative costs, increased potential for errors.
3. Globalization:
Description: The increasing reliance on international sourcing, manufacturing, and distribution.
Sources:
Longer Lead Times: Goods travel across oceans, taking weeks or months.
Increased Risk: Geopolitical instability, trade wars, customs delays, natural disasters in distant lands.
Cultural Differences: Communication barriers, varying business practices.
Currency Fluctuations: Impact on costs and revenue.
Impact: Higher transportation costs, greater risk exposure, complex legal and regulatory compliance.
4. Supply Chain Risk:
Description: The potential for disruptions that can severely impact supply chain operations and performance.
Sources:
Natural Disasters: Earthquakes, floods, pandemics (e.g., COVID-19).
Man-Made Disasters: Fires, power outages, cyberattacks.
Geopolitical Events: Wars, trade sanctions, political instability.
Supplier Failures: Bankruptcy, quality issues, labor disputes.
Logistics Disruptions: Port strikes, shipping lane blockages (e.g., Suez Canal).
Impact: Production stoppages, lost sales, reputational damage, increased costs.
The "Bullwhip Effect": A Classic Supply Chain Phenomenon
One of the most significant and often cited obstacles in supply chain management is the Bullwhip Effect.
Concept: Small fluctuations in customer demand at the retail level get amplified and distorted as they move upstream through the supply chain (retailer → wholesaler → manufacturer → supplier).
Analogy: Imagine cracking a whip. A small flick of the wrist (small demand change) results in a large, violent snap at the tip of the whip (large fluctuations in orders further upstream).
Causes:
Demand Forecast Updating: Each stage updates its forecast based on orders received from the downstream stage, not actual consumer demand.
Order Batching: Ordering in large, infrequent batches to achieve economies of scale (e.g., full truckloads).
Price Fluctuations: Promotional pricing or quantity discounts encourage larger, less frequent orders.
Rationing/Shortage Gaming: When supply is limited, customers over-order to get a larger share, distorting true demand.
Consequences:
Excess inventory and high holding costs.
Frequent stockouts and lost sales.
Increased transportation and production costs (rush orders, overtime).
Poor customer service.
Damaged relationships between supply chain partners.
Mitigating the Bullwhip Effect: Key strategies include:
Information Sharing: Sharing actual point-of-sale (POS) data across the chain.
Channel Alignment: Implementing Vendor-Managed Inventory (VMI) or Collaborative Planning, Forecasting, and Replenishment (CPFR).
Everyday Low Prices (EDLP): Reducing price promotions.
Smaller, More Frequent Orders: Reducing batching.
